Output dc2c6830c52d998a3059a19741d90c1e3e664e22cf8964ffdfe34a922a6b3ebd:0

value
19412208
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d73805088afd68f55ac51875f73c2b794f9b7b1 OP_EQUAL
address
3G3YNpvxTtwXqf51P7CtcpNNrzAwAL87Ue
transaction
dc2c6830c52d998a3059a19741d90c1e3e664e22cf8964ffdfe34a922a6b3ebd
spent
true